The Importance of PalletsPallets function as a robust and movable platform that permits the safe transportation and storage of products. Made generally from wood, plastic, or metal, pallets are essential for logistics, as they facilitate stacking and managing with forklifts and pallet jacks.

Table 1: Common Uses for Pallets

Market Common Uses

Retail Keeping inventory, showing products

Warehousing Transporting bulk products

Production Moving raw products and ended up items

Agriculture Saving fruit and vegetables, chemicals

Building and construction Carrying tools and products

Plastic Pallets

Lightweight and resistant to moisture and chemicals

Perfect for markets involving food or pharmaceuticals

Typically recyclable and can be sterilized quickly

Metal Pallets

Long lasting and efficient in standing up to heavy loads

Table 2: Comparison of Pallet Types

Pallet Type Material Weight Load Capacity Rate Range

Wooden Softwood/H wood Heavy High (as much as 2,500 pounds) ₤ 10 - ₤ 25 each

Plastic Polyethylene Light Medium (up to 2,000 lbs) ₤ 15 - ₤ 50 each

Metal Steel/Aluminum Heavy Very High (up to 5,000 pounds) ₤ 50 - ₤ 150 each

Composite Wood/Plastic Medium Medium (up to 2,500 lbs) ₤ 20 - ₤ 60 each

The Manufacturing ProcessProducing pallets involves a number of distinct phases to guarantee quality and durability. The typical production process includes the following actions:

Material Selection: The choice of material (wood, plastic, or metal) is critical and can be influenced by spending plan, intended use, and environmental factors to consider.

Cutting and Assembly: In wooden pallet manufacturing, lumber is cut to size before being put together into a pallet frame. In plastic and metal pallets, molds or welding techniques are used for building and construction.

Completing: This action might include sanding Wooden Shipping Pallets pallets to get rid of splinters, including coverings to avoid decay, or applying heat treatments to boost strength.

Quality Control: Each batch of pallets undergoes strict screening to ensure it fulfills industry requirements regarding resilience and resistance to numerous conditions.

Distribution: Finally, pallets are packaged and delivered to storage facilities, distributors, or straight to customers.

Frequently Asked Questions About Pallet Manufacturing

Q1: What is the typical life expectancy of a wooden pallet?
Wooden Pallets Manufacturer typically last in between 3 to five years, depending upon the use, maintenance, and environment.

Q2: Are plastic pallets more pricey than wooden pallets?
Yes, plastic pallets often have a higher upfront cost, however they can be more affordable in the long run due to their sturdiness and recyclability.

Q3: Can pallets be recycled?
Yes, pallets can be reused numerous times. Numerous business implement pallet return programs to recirculate pallets successfully.

Q4: What aspects should I think about when picking a pallet type?
Think about the weight of the items, temperature conditions, dealing with techniques, expense, and particular market regulations.

Q5: How can I ensure sustainability in my pallet supply chain?
Go with pallets made from recycled products, carry out a repair work and reuse program, and deal with makers committed to sustainable practices.
